diff options
| author | Jason Rumney | 2000-11-23 20:56:49 +0000 |
|---|---|---|
| committer | Jason Rumney | 2000-11-23 20:56:49 +0000 |
| commit | d19249e73440f9908f79cf43bbf4f10dbe6e88cc (patch) | |
| tree | a900afb1b5423886e3a7b6bb1fc5cf187bcdf67c /lib-src/makefile.w32-in | |
| parent | cc362d7696cdec02097005bb20109facd0c39fe6 (diff) | |
| download | emacs-d19249e73440f9908f79cf43bbf4f10dbe6e88cc.tar.gz emacs-d19249e73440f9908f79cf43bbf4f10dbe6e88cc.zip | |
(ebrowse): New target.
(LOCAL_FLAGS): Add -DVERSION flag.
Diffstat (limited to 'lib-src/makefile.w32-in')
| -rw-r--r-- | lib-src/makefile.w32-in | 15 |
1 files changed, 13 insertions, 2 deletions
diff --git a/lib-src/makefile.w32-in b/lib-src/makefile.w32-in index 3654e82d01f..807aca6e489 100644 --- a/lib-src/makefile.w32-in +++ b/lib-src/makefile.w32-in | |||
| @@ -19,12 +19,13 @@ | |||
| 19 | # Boston, MA 02111-1307, USA. | 19 | # Boston, MA 02111-1307, USA. |
| 20 | # | 20 | # |
| 21 | 21 | ||
| 22 | ALL = make-docfile hexl ctags etags movemail fakemail | 22 | ALL = make-docfile hexl ctags etags movemail fakemail ebrowse |
| 23 | 23 | ||
| 24 | .PHONY: $(ALL) | 24 | .PHONY: $(ALL) |
| 25 | 25 | ||
| 26 | LOCAL_FLAGS = -DWINDOWSNT -DDOS_NT -DSTDC_HEADERS=1 -DNO_LDAV=1 \ | 26 | LOCAL_FLAGS = -DWINDOWSNT -DDOS_NT -DSTDC_HEADERS=1 -DNO_LDAV=1 \ |
| 27 | -DNO_ARCHIVES=1 -DHAVE_CONFIG_H=1 -I../nt/inc -I../src | 27 | -DNO_ARCHIVES=1 -DHAVE_CONFIG_H=1 -I../nt/inc \ |
| 28 | -I../src -DVERSION="\"$(VERSION)\"" | ||
| 28 | 29 | ||
| 29 | # don't know what (if) to do with these yet... | 30 | # don't know what (if) to do with these yet... |
| 30 | # | 31 | # |
| @@ -51,6 +52,7 @@ $(BLD)/fakemail.exe: $(BLD)/fakemail.$(O) $(BLD)/ntlib.$(O) | |||
| 51 | make-docfile: $(BLD) $(BLD)/make-docfile.exe | 52 | make-docfile: $(BLD) $(BLD)/make-docfile.exe |
| 52 | ctags: $(BLD) $(BLD)/ctags.exe | 53 | ctags: $(BLD) $(BLD)/ctags.exe |
| 53 | etags: $(BLD) $(BLD)/etags.exe | 54 | etags: $(BLD) $(BLD)/etags.exe |
| 55 | ebrowse: $(BLD) $(BLD)/ebrowse.exe | ||
| 54 | hexl: $(BLD) $(BLD)/hexl.exe | 56 | hexl: $(BLD) $(BLD)/hexl.exe |
| 55 | movemail: $(BLD) $(BLD)/movemail.exe | 57 | movemail: $(BLD) $(BLD)/movemail.exe |
| 56 | fakemail: $(BLD) $(BLD)/fakemail.exe | 58 | fakemail: $(BLD) $(BLD)/fakemail.exe |
| @@ -76,6 +78,14 @@ $(BLD)/etags.exe: $(ETAGSOBJ) | |||
| 76 | $(LINK) $(LINK_OUT)$@ $(LINK_FLAGS) $(ETAGSOBJ) $(LIBS) | 78 | $(LINK) $(LINK_OUT)$@ $(LINK_FLAGS) $(ETAGSOBJ) $(LIBS) |
| 77 | 79 | ||
| 78 | 80 | ||
| 81 | EBROWSEOBJ = $(BLD)/ebrowse.$(O) \ | ||
| 82 | $(BLD)/getopt.$(O) \ | ||
| 83 | $(BLD)/getopt1.$(O) \ | ||
| 84 | $(BLD)/ntlib.$(O) | ||
| 85 | |||
| 86 | $(BLD)/ebrowse.exe: $(EBROWSEOBJ) | ||
| 87 | $(LINK) $(LINK_OUT)$@ $(LINK_FLAGS) $(EBROWSEOBJ) $(LIBS) | ||
| 88 | |||
| 79 | $(BLD)/regex.$(O): ../src/regex.c ../src/regex.h ../src/config.h | 89 | $(BLD)/regex.$(O): ../src/regex.c ../src/regex.h ../src/config.h |
| 80 | $(CC) $(CFLAGS) -DCONFIG_BROKETS -DINHIBIT_STRING_HEADER \ | 90 | $(CC) $(CFLAGS) -DCONFIG_BROKETS -DINHIBIT_STRING_HEADER \ |
| 81 | ../src/regex.c $(CC_OUT)$@ | 91 | ../src/regex.c $(CC_OUT)$@ |
| @@ -216,6 +226,7 @@ INSTALL_FILES = $(ALL) | |||
| 216 | install: $(INSTALL_FILES) | 226 | install: $(INSTALL_FILES) |
| 217 | - mkdir "$(INSTALL_DIR)/bin" | 227 | - mkdir "$(INSTALL_DIR)/bin" |
| 218 | $(CP) $(BLD)/etags.exe $(INSTALL_DIR)/bin | 228 | $(CP) $(BLD)/etags.exe $(INSTALL_DIR)/bin |
| 229 | $(CP) $(BLD)/ebrowse.exe $(INSTALL_DIR)/bin | ||
| 219 | $(CP) $(BLD)/ctags.exe $(INSTALL_DIR)/bin | 230 | $(CP) $(BLD)/ctags.exe $(INSTALL_DIR)/bin |
| 220 | $(CP) $(BLD)/hexl.exe $(INSTALL_DIR)/bin | 231 | $(CP) $(BLD)/hexl.exe $(INSTALL_DIR)/bin |
| 221 | $(CP) $(BLD)/movemail.exe $(INSTALL_DIR)/bin | 232 | $(CP) $(BLD)/movemail.exe $(INSTALL_DIR)/bin |